目的比较异丙酚复合氯胺酮用于短小手术麻醉的临床效果。方法选择ASAⅠ~Ⅱ级短小手术患者100例,分为氯胺酮组(K组)和异丙酚复合氯胺酮组(PK组)各50例。入室后静脉注射咪唑安定0.05 mg/kg,手术开始前静脉注射氯胺酮1~2 mg/kg,术中维持:K组用氯胺酮0.5 mg/(kg.h)持续输入至术毕,PK组用异丙酚4~5 mg/(kg.h)、氯胺酮0.5 mg/(kg.h)持续输入至术毕,观察相关指标。结果K组术中及术毕至苏醒期BP、HR明显升高(P<0.05);术中需要追加氯胺酮者K组15例,PK组4例;清醒时间K组(15±7)分钟,PK组(11±5)分钟;K组有2例出现苏醒期躁动。结论异丙酚复合氯胺酮麻醉术中更平稳,苏醒时间短,不良反应少。  相似文献

目的探讨小儿疝气手术患儿使用雷米芬太尼复合异丙酚麻醉的效果。方法择期行疝气手术患儿48例,年龄4~12岁,按年龄和麻醉药物分为四组,每组12例:IPK组4~7岁,氯胺酮复合异丙酚麻醉;IPR组4~7岁,雷米芬太尼复合异丙酚麻醉;ⅡPK组8~12岁,氯胺酮复合异丙酚麻醉;ⅡPR组8~12岁,雷米芬太尼复合异丙酚麻醉。IPK组和ⅡPK静脉注射氯胺酮2 mg/kg和异丙酚2 mg/kg麻醉诱导,静脉输注异丙酚6 mg/(kg.h)及间断静脉注射氯胺酮1~2 mg/kg维持麻醉。IPR组和ⅡPR组静脉注射雷米芬太尼1μg/kg和异丙酚2 mg/kg麻醉诱导;麻醉维持:静脉注射异丙酚6 mg/(kg.min)和雷米芬太尼0.1μg/(kg.min),雷米芬太尼每2分钟增加0.025μg/(kg.min),直至0.2μg/(kg.min)。于麻醉诱导前、麻醉诱导后冲洗眼球时,手术开始后即刻、手术开始后15 min和出手术室时,记录收缩压(SBP)、舒张压(DBP)、心率(HR)、呼吸频率(RR)、脉搏、血氧饱和度和麻醉深度指数(CSI)。记录术中和术后不良反应的发生情况,记录麻醉诱导时间、苏醒时间、意识恢复时间和总镇静时间,计算雷米芬太尼平均输注速率。结果与麻醉诱导前比较,四组SBP、DBP、HR、RR和CSI均降低(P0.05);与IPK组和ⅡPK组比较,IPR组和ⅡPR组RR和CSI降低,术中体动和术后躁动发生率降低,麻醉诱导时间延长,苏醒时间和意识恢复时间缩短(P0.05);与IPR组比较,ⅡPR组麻醉诱导时间和意识恢复时间缩短(P0.05)。ⅡPK组雷米芬太尼平均输注速率小于IPK组(P0.05)。结论雷米芬太尼复合异丙酚用于小儿疝气手术患儿麻醉可产生良好的麻醉效果,且血流动力学平稳,不良反应少,术后苏醒迅速,而不同年龄患儿雷米芬太尼用量不同。  相似文献

目的探讨瑞芬太尼-异丙酚麻醉在小儿气管异物取出术中的应用效果、血流动力学变化及并发症情况。方法选择ASA分级Ⅰ~Ⅲ级标准、年龄1~5岁、行气管异物取出术患儿30例,随机分为两组,每组15例。瑞芬太尼复合异丙酚组(RP组)氯胺酮5~8 mg/kg肌肉注射,异丙酚2 mg/kg静脉诱导,术中持续泵注异丙酚1~2 mg/(kg.h)及瑞芬太尼0.03~0.08μg/(kg.min),异物取出后停止给药。γ-羟基丁酸钠复合氯胺酮组(γk组)氯胺酮5~8 mg/kg肌肉注射,静脉注射γ-羟丁酸钠60~80 mg/kg诱导麻醉,术中麻醉深度不足时分次静脉滴注氯胺酮1.5 mg/kg至麻醉满意,并根据手术需要分次追加氯胺酮1 mg/kg。记录麻醉前、诱导、下镜、探查、取出、术毕各时间平均动脉压、心率及动脉血氧饱和度。观察两组苏醒时间,对比两组患儿拔管后上呼吸道梗阻或屏气、苏醒期躁动、术后恶心呕吐的发生率。结果 RP组诱导、下镜、探查、取出时平均动脉压、呼吸、心率、血氧饱和度较麻醉前均有下降(P0.05),但尚在正常范围,与γK组相比差异亦有统计学意义(P0.05)。瑞芬太尼起效迅速,恶心呕吐、苏醒期躁动、支气管痉挛和术后舌后坠的发生较对照组少,苏醒时间短,而且苏醒效果佳,与对照组相比差异有统计学意义(P0.05)。结论瑞芬太尼、丙泊酚复合静脉麻醉可安全有效地用于小儿气管异物取出术,并具有血流动力学稳定、手术麻醉患儿苏醒时间短和苏醒质量高的优点。  相似文献

目的:探讨全凭异丙酚-氯胺酮复合麻醉在乳癌根治术中的效果及安全性。方法:选60例乳癌根治术患者,均先静注异丙酚1.2 mg/kg、氯胺酮0.8 mg/kg,再以异丙酚4 mg/(kg.h)、氯胺酮1.2 mg/(kg.h)维持,观察比较麻醉前、注药后2 min、注药后10 min、切皮时、手术开始0.5 h、手术开始1 h、停药时和术毕时的MAP、HR和SpO2值以及术毕清醒状况。结果:以上各时段的血流动力学和呼吸功能指标无明显差异(P<0.05),术毕苏醒满意。结论:全凭异丙酚-氯胺酮复合麻醉在乳癌根治术中的应用是可行的。  相似文献

目的:观察异丙酚联合氯胺酮静脉麻醉在小儿斜疝修补手术中应用的安全性、可行性及优点。方法:选择择期行斜疝修补手术的小儿患者40例,随机分成两组,Ⅰ组(实验组)采用异丙酚复合氯胺酮静脉麻醉,Ⅱ组(对照组)采用氯胺酮加地西泮静脉麻醉。麻醉过程中监测循环呼吸相关参数,同时记录麻醉效果、不良反应、氯胺酮用量及术后苏醒时间。结果:Ⅰ组的氯胺酮用量明显少于Ⅱ组(P〈0.05),术后苏醒时间明显短于Ⅱ组(P〈0.05),术后躁动等不良反应少于Ⅱ组。结论:异丙酚复合氯胺酮静脉麻醉用于小儿斜疝修补手术比氯胺酮加地西泮具有更多优点。  相似文献

目的观察丙泊酚复合氯胺酮应用于小儿眼科手术麻醉时对呼吸循环的影响及麻醉恢复情况,并与单纯氯胺酮作比较,探讨一种较为理想的复合用药方法。方法择期行眼科手术的患儿40例,采用随机数字表法分为2组:A组20例,肌注氯胺酮6.0~8.0mg/kg,术中酌情静脉追加氯胺酮1.0~2.0mg·kg-1/次;B组20例,肌注氯胺酮2.0~3.0mg/kg,并于手术开始前2min静脉注射丙泊酚1mg/kg,后以氯胺酮1.5~2.5mg/(kg·h)和丙泊酚6~10mg/(kg·h)持续静脉微泵输注,术毕前5min同时停用。监测心率(HR)、平均动脉压(MAP)、RR及SPO2的变化,并记录氯胺酮的用量、术后的清醒情况及恶心呕吐的发生率。结果A组患儿的MAP、HR在手术开始后明显高于基础值(P<0.05);B组患儿在手术开始时MAP和HR较基础值稍有增加(P<0.05),但术中渐降至术前水平或稍低,并保持平稳至术毕;两组患儿的SPO2和RR与基础值相比无显著差异。B组术中氯胺酮的用量和清醒时间明显少于A组,呼吸抑制和术后呕吐发生率亦明显低于A组(P<0.01)。结论与单纯氯胺酮相比,丙泊酚复合氯胺酮能更好的保持呼吸循环稳定,缩短术后清醒时间,减少恶心呕吐的发生,是一种较理想的小儿眼科手术麻醉方法。  相似文献

This is a new method for the determination of creatine kinase isoenzyme MB activity in serum. The method uses direct activity measurement of creatine kinase B subunit activity after blocking of CK-M subunit activity by inhibiting antibodies. The test takes no longer than 15 min. The method yields an intra-serial C.V. of 2.0-12.9%, and a C.V. from day to day of 5.5%. The detection limit is 3.4 U/l creatine kinase MB. In the 95 cases with proven myocardial infarction several types of creatine kinase MB activity kinetics could be determined. The percentage of creatine kinase MB of peak CK-total is 6-25%, with a mean of 11.1%. The amount of creatine kinase MB with respect to total CK activity after reinfarction is higher than the amount after initial infarction.  相似文献

Although substantial evidence suggests that the prefrontal cortex (PFC) implements processes that are critical for accurate episodic memory judgments, the specific roles of different PFC subregions remain unclear. Here, we used event-related functional magnetic resonance imaging to distinguish between prefrontal activity related to operations that (1) influence processing of retrieval cues based on current task demands, or (2) are involved in monitoring the outputs of retrieval. Fourteen participants studied auditory words spoken by a male or female speaker and completed memory tests in which the stimuli were unstudied foil words and studied words spoken by either the same speaker at study, or the alternate speaker. On "general" test trials, participants were to determine whether each word was studied, regardless of the voice of the speaker, whereas on "specific" test trials, participants were to additionally distinguish between studied words that were spoken in the same voice or a different voice at study. Thus, on specific test trials, participants were explicitly required to attend to voice information in order to evaluate each test item. Anterior (right BA 10), dorsolateral prefrontal (right BA 46), and inferior frontal (bilateral BA 47/12) regions were more active during specific than during general trials. Activation in anterior and dorsolateral PFC was enhanced during specific test trials even in response to unstudied items, suggesting that activation in these regions was related to the differential processing of retrieval cues in the two tasks. In contrast, differences between specific and general test trials in inferior frontal regions (bilateral BA 47/12) were seen only for studied items, suggesting a role for these regions in post-retrieval monitoring processes. Results from this study are consistent with the idea that different PFC subregions implement distinct, but complementary processes that collectively support accurate episodic memory judgments.  相似文献

目的 探讨俯卧位通气对高海拔地区肺复张术(RM)治疗无效急性呼吸窘迫综合征(ARDS)患者的治疗作用.方法 从海拔2260m的地区医院筛选RM治疗无效的41例ARDS患者[平均氧合指数( PaO2/FiO2)较RM前升高<20%视为RM无效],依不同病因分为肺内源性ARDS组(ARDSp组)和肺外源性ARDS组(ARDSexp组),每组再按信封法随机分为俯卧位组和仰卧位组,即ARDSp俯卧位组(11例)、ARDSp仰卧位组(9例)、ARDSexp俯卧位组(10例)、ARDSexp仰卧位组(11例).在通气前及通气1、2、3、4h监测动脉血氧分压( PaO2)、PaO2/FiO2、静态顺应性(Cst)、气道阻力(Raw)的变化.结果 通气lh时,ARDSexp俯卧位组PaO2/FiO2( mm Hg,l mm Hg=0.133 kPa)即较通气前显著升高(157.4±40.6比129.3±48.7,P<0.05),并随通气时间延长呈持续增高趋势,4h达峰值(219.1 ±41.1);且ARDSexp俯卧位组通气3h内PaO2/FiO2较其他3组显著增高,另3组间则差异无统计学意义.ARDSp俯卧位组、ARDSexp俯卧位组通气4h时PaO2/FiO2均较相应仰卧位组显著增高(208.8±39.7比127.4±47.1,219.1±41.1比124.9±50.8,均P<0.05).4组通气前后Cst无显著改变,各组间差异也无统计学意义.ARDSp俯卧位组通气4h时Raw(cmH2O·L-1·s-1)较通气前显著降低(6.8±1.7比10.7±1.8,P<0.05),且明显低于其他3组;其他3组各时间点Raw组内及组间比较差异均无统计学意义.结论 俯卧位通气作为ARDS机械通气重要策略之一,可以改善RM无效高原ARDS患者的氧合,为抢救患者赢得宝贵的时间.  相似文献

The Department of Veterans Affairs (VA) in the USA operates a network of 172 medical centres which all utilize a hospital information system (HIS) which has been developed and is currently maintained by the VA. During the past several years, an image management and communication module has been developed, installed and clinically utilized at the Washington DC and Maryland VA Medical Centres. This image management and communication system, referred to as the decentralized hospital computer program (DHCP) imaging system, is fully integrated with a commercial picture archiving and communication system (PACS). The system is utilized to capture, archive, and display all images generated within the hospital including radiology, nuclear medicine, pathology, endoscopy, bronchoscopy, and dermatology, intraoperative photographs, ECG data, and a limited number of paper documents. The ultimate goal of the project is to have all patient text and image data available at any clinical workstation to any authorized user anywhere within the network of medical centres. Clinical requirements for an imaging workstation include ease of use, rapid and reliable access to the complete set of patient information, and images which are of acceptable quality to meet the requirements of the user and the subspecialty. Patient confidentiality and data security must be safeguarded at all times. Integration of the images with the remainder of the patient's database was found to be critical to the success of the project. The experience at the Washington and Maryland facilities suggests that an imaging system that is successfully integrated with a hospital information system can provide substantial clinical and economic benefits both within and among medical centres. Clinical acceptance and utilization of the system has been excellent, particularly in diagnostic radiology where DHCP Imaging has been interfaced to a commercial PAC system. Based upon this initial experience, the VA has begun to deploy the system throughout its large network of medical centres.  相似文献

Myocardial elastography is a novel method for noninvasively assessing regional myocardial function, with the advantages of high spatial and temporal resolution and high signal-to-noise ratio (SNR). In this paper, in-vivo experiments were performed in anesthetized normal and infarcted mice (one day after left anterior descending coronary artery [LAD] ligation) using a high-resolution (30 MHz) ultrasound system (Vevo 770, VisualSonics Inc., Toronto, ON, Canada). Radiofrequency (RF) signals of the left ventricle (LV) in longitudinal (long-axis) view and the associated electrocardiogram (ECG) were simultaneously acquired. Using a retrospective ECG gating technique, 2-D full field-of-view RF frames were acquired at an extremely high frame rate (8 kHz) that resulted in high-quality incremental displacement and strain estimation of the myocardium. The incremental results were further accumulated to obtain the cumulative displacements and strains. Two-dimensional and M-mode displacement images and strain images (elastograms), as well as displacement and strain profiles as a function of time, were compared between normal and infarcted mice. Incremental results clearly depicted cardiac events including LV contraction, LV relaxation and isovolumetric phases in both normal and infarcted mice, and also evidently indicated reduced motion and deformation in the infarcted myocardium. The elastograms indicated that the infarcted regions underwent thinning during systole rather than thickening, as in the normal case. The cumulative elastograms were found to have higher elastographic SNR (SNR(e)) than the incremental elastograms (e.g., 10.6 vs. 4.7 in a normal myocardium, and 6.0 vs. 2.4 in an infarcted myocardium). Finally, preliminary statistical results from nine normal (m = 9) and seven infarcted (n = 7) mice indicated the capability of the cumulative strain in differentiating infracted from normal myocardia. In conclusion, myocardial elastography could provide regional strain information at simultaneously high temporal (>/=0.125 ms) and spatial ( approximately 55 microm) resolution as well as high precision ( approximately 0.05 microm displacement). This technique was thus capable of accurately characterizing normal myocardial function throughout an entire cardiac cycle, at the same high resolution, and detecting and localizing myocardial infarction in vivo.  相似文献

目的 探讨手转胎头术失败的原因与分娩结局.方法 选择2008年1月至2010年12月于我院住院分娩的持续性枕横位、枕后位产妇198例,根据行手转胎头术后结果分为成功组126例、失败组72例.比较两组分娩结局,对比分析失败原因.结果 失败组胎儿体质量≥3500 g的发生率[76.4%(55/72)]明显高于成功组[31.7%(40/126)],差异有统计学意义(x2=30.177,P=0.001)、失败组宫缩乏力发生率[58.3%(42/72)]高于成功组[38.1% (48/126)],差异有统计学意义(x2=7.569,P=0.006)、失败组骨盆临界或轻度狭窄发生率[38.9% (28/72)]高于成功组[23.8%(30/126)],差异有统计学意义(x2 =5.030,P=0.002)、失败组手转胎头时机不当(宫口开大<6 cm、胎头位于坐骨棘上及宫口开大8~10 cm、胎头位于坐骨棘下≥2 cm)发生率[61.1%(44/72)]高于成功组[38.9%(49/126)],差异有统计学意义(x2=9.084,P=0.003).失败组母儿并发症(产后出血、产褥病率、胎儿窘迫、新生儿窒息)发生率高于成功组(x2 =9.586,P=0.002、x2=9.334,P=0.002、x2=5.910,P=0.015、x2=5.240,P=0.022)、失败组剖宫产发生率[72.2%(52/72)]明显高于成功组[34.1 %(43/126),x2=26.641,P=0.001)].结论 手转胎头术能使难产变顺产,降低剖宫产率,减少母儿并发症,但须积极预防、处理导致手转胎头术失败的原因,对矫正失败后继续矫正及试产应慎重.  相似文献
